Benutzer-Werkzeuge

Webseiten-Werkzeuge


start:quickies:corona:pauschale_per_sql

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.


Vorhergehende Überarbeitung
start:quickies:corona:pauschale_per_sql [2023/01/21 20:17] (aktuell) – angelegt - Externe Bearbeitung 127.0.0.1
Zeile 1: Zeile 1:
 +====== Hygiene-Mehrbedarf (HygMB) in bereits abgeschlossenen Rezepten nachtragen ... ======
  
 +Bereits abgeschlossene Verordnungen müssen entweder nochmals geöffnet werden, um die Hygiene-Pauschale im Rezeptformular zu aktivieren **[[bedienung:quickies:corona:hygienemehrbedarf#Handhabung|(s. o.)]]**, oder man trägt die Pauschale über einen SQL-Befehl nach:\\ \\ 
 +''UPDATE verordn SET pauschale=true WHERE rez_nr IN (SELECT rez_nr FROM fertige WHERE NOT ediok='T')''
 +
 +<WRAP center round alert 60%>
 +Achtung! Die Änderungen werden mit Betätigen der Taste <key>execute</key> ohne Rückfrage sofort in die Datenbank geschrieben!
 +Wer sich nicht sicher ist, sollte sich von einem erfahrenen Nutzer helfen lassen!
 +</WRAP>
 +
 +
 +<WRAP center round important 60%>
 +Die Pauschale muss vor dem Taxieren eingetragen werden.
 +
 +Der SQL-Befehl bearbeitet nur Verordnungen, bei denen der grüne Haken (noch) nicht gesetzt ist.
 +</WRAP>
 +
 +
 +**Tipp:**\\
 +Der SQL-Befehl kann ohne Nebenwirkungen mehrfach ausgeführt werden. Es ist also möglich
 +  - den Haken zu entfernen (bei einer oder mehreren VOs) 
 +  - SQL-Befehl ausführen
 +  - Fokus erneut auf die VO setzen, damit die Tabelle mit den Behandlungstagen neu aufgebaut wird\\ (z. B. indem man zwischendurch auf die Kasse und anschließend wieder auf die VO klickt)\\
 +  - jetzt sollte die Pauschale am letzten Behandlungstag 'dranhängen'
 +  - VO neu taxieren und Haken setzen
 +  - die Reihenfolge dieser Schritte ist beliebig
 +
 +====== Hygiene-Mehrbedarf löschen ======
 +Natürlich lässt sich die Pauschale im SQL-Modul auch per SQL-Befehl deaktivieren, sobald sie nicht mehr abgerechnet werden kann:\\ \\ 
 +''UPDATE verordn SET pauschale='F' WHERE rez_nr IN (SELECT rez_nr FROM fertige WHERE NOT ediok='T')''